Location - The village of Withybrook is situated in North Warwickshire close to the Leicestershire border, having its own church, village hall which offers many social activities and a public house. Rugby, Hinckley, Coventry and Nuneaton are easily accessible and offer extensive schools, shopping, and sporting facilities. Withybrook is conveniently situated for access to London with a frequent high speed rail Service from both Coventry and Rugby to London Euston (just under 50 minutes from Rugby). Birmingham International Airport is approximately 25 miles away.
